    Here is my situation,

    I’m not new to the 2nd Gen Prius world, In fact I’ve replaced the hybrid battery, fixed the dash capacitor issue, fuel pump and so on.

    About a week ago I was driving my Prius to church and it died in the middle of the road and shifted itself to neutral. I put it in park and tried turn it on and off again but since then it will try to turn on for about 2 seconds and then quit. I had to have it towed but now am wondering how to fix it.

    leading up to this is had been having to reset the dash lights about ever other time I drove it for an unknown issue. I took it to three auto parts stores and couldn’t get a code. The hybrid battery is good and seemed to always stay charged.

    I have recently replaced the fuel pump, it has an aftermarket CAT, and I have soldered a new capacitor on the dash recently.

    I’m looking for ideas on how to get it back on the road!

    Dash lights generally mean there are obd2 codes stored in the computers (ECUs), retrieve the codes and post in here for additional advice.
    Just a WAG, but when was the last time the inverter coolant pump was replaced?
